Now, I would like to use an Epson Perfection 1660,
high-speed usb
scanner. My distro is a Debian AMD64 SID / computer AMD64x2,
2Gb RAM.
All software is updated to last Debian SID versions. Scanner
is
connected to a high-speed 2.0 usb port.
Everything works fine in low resolutions (< 800 dpi).
When choosing color/1600 dpi or more, xsane prints the
following error:
Out of memory. Any idea?
